Atlantic International Corp.

Atlantic International Corp. operates as a staffing company servicing the commercial, professional, finance, direct placement, and managed service provider verticals. The company specializes in permanent, temporary, and temporary-to-permanent placement services in various areas, including accounting and finance, administrative and clerical, hospitality, information technology, legal, staffing, light industrial, and medical fields. It also provides productivity consulting and workforce management solutions. The company was founded in 2018 and is based in Englewood Cliffs, New Jersey.
